What is Coated Duplex Board?
Coated duplex board is a type of paperboard made from a combination of recycled pulp and wood fibers. The board is typically coated on one side—a stark white surface that is ideal for vibrant printing and color reproduction—while the reverse side is left uncoated or is coated in a grey color. This grey back not only adds to the strength of the board, enhancing its durability, but also makes it less transparent, hiding the contents of the packaging from view.
This board is characterized by its lightweight yet sturdy structure, making it a practical option for a wide range of applications, including food packaging,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, and more. It stands out particularly in sectors where aesthetic appeal and product protection are paramount.

Applications of Coated Duplex Board
Coated duplex board is used across a multitude of industries. In the food industry, it offers excellent protection for delicate items while ensuring that the product’s presentation is appealing. The high-quality printability enables brands to create eye-catching packaging that stands out on store shelves.
In the cosmetics and pharmaceuticals sectors, the durability and aesthetic properties of the board allow for elaborate designs that can effectively communicate the brand message while ensuring the safe transport of fragile products. Additionally, it is also popular in the manufacturing of display boxes, cartons, and labels, further showcasing its versatility.
